the second IC is close to what I have in my truck.
the first one "looks" too small.
biggest problem with too small of an IC is that it can't shed heat fast enough. it won't hurt your performance, but it won't help much either. that's why you see the racer crowd ice down their IC's between runs.
On a sidebar, it's now 5/2011. the install you see in the early pages is still there and functioning fine. I've changed out the IP a couple of times, but I haven't had to touch anything else from the install. imho, the IC is still the next best power adder to a turbo. it really broadens the powerband and requires no maintenance other than periodic inspection of the hose couplings and washing the bugs off the front of the IC. nothing else to tune/tweak or rebuild.

i know this is an older post that someone brought back but i just want to throw my findings out there. Also im kind of in a different ball park than you guys being a cummins but what the heck.

Before install: with 410 gears and a zf5

max 24 lbs of boost @ max of 1200 deg in 5th full bore
going down the freeway in 5th at about 60mph i tipically see about 5-7lbs of boost and about 700-800 deg and about 2300-2500 rpm

Installed an ebay cxracing intercooler with 3" piping
Max 20 lbs of boost @ max of 950-1000 deg in 5th full bore.
going down the freeway in 5th at about 60mph i see about 4-5 lbs of boost and about 550-650 deg and about 2300-2500 rpm

I know i lost a little bit of boost but that is normal. I feel the truck has more get up and go and requires less throttle to do that same work as before. I am very happy with my intercooler and i wish i had installed it sooner. Also i gained about 2 MPG in fuel ;Sweet and let me tell you. Courtesy of Dave S.

26"x 23"x 3.5" spearco Cu inches 2093

26.5"x 21"x 2.5" stock 6.0 cu inches 1391.25

29.5” x 18”x 2.25” Banks. Cu inches 1194

29”x 18” x 2” Superduty 7.3 cu inches 1044


These measurements are the core only.
